"DAVID BYRNEDavid Byrne has announced 2026 dates for his Who Is the Sky? tour, with festival stops at Coachella and Big Ears and headline shows in Phoenix, Portland, Houston, Milwaukee, Cleveland, Nashville and more. DAVEUK rapper Dave has announced a 2026 North American tour in support of this year's The Boy Who Played the Harp. It kicks off in late March on the West Coast, and it wraps up with two nights in NYC."
"BRIGHT EYESBright Eyes will celebrate 21 years of the albums they released on the same day in 2005, I'm Wide Awake, It's Morning and Digital Ash in a Digital Urn, with three special shows in 2026. OUTLINE SPRINGThe Spits, Times New Viking (first show in a decade), SNÕÕPER, Prison Affair and The Serfs playing Outline at Knockdown Center on March 6."
"SWEET PILLSSweet Pill have announced a 2026 tour in support of their upcoming second album. TOTO / CHRISTOPHER CROSS / THE ROMANTICSWe're not quite sure how The Romantics fit in with the more yacht-rocky sounds of Christopher Cross and Toto, but this triple bill tour will deliver the '80s hits. Dates include hits NJ's PNC Bank Arts Center on 7/18 and Long Island's Jones Beach on 7/19."
